Emotional Intelligence in Communication

Emotional intelligence in communication is the ability to express yourself with empathy, understand others’ emotions, and manage emotional responses during interactions. It transforms conversations from reactive to meaningful, helping people connect more authentically in both personal and professional relationships.

Why Emotional Intelligence Matters in Communication

Every word carries emotion. Without emotional intelligence, we risk being misunderstood or misreading others. Daniel Goleman describes emotional intelligence as “the capacity for recognizing our own feelings and those of others, for motivating ourselves, and for managing emotions well.” This awareness turns communication into connection.

When emotions are regulated, communication becomes clearer, calmer, and more constructive. Emotional intelligence helps us choose understanding over judgment , a powerful shift in every relationship.

Core Skills of Emotionally Intelligent Communication

  • Active Listening: Focus on understanding, not reacting.
  • Empathetic Expression: Validate emotions rather than dismiss them.
  • Emotional Regulation: Stay calm even when conversations become tense.
  • Authentic Honesty: Speak from truth, not ego or fear.
  • Nonverbal Awareness: Read tone, posture, and facial cues.

Practical Ways to Communicate with Emotional Intelligence

Start by slowing down. When you feel triggered, breathe before replying. Ask questions instead of assuming intent. Use statements like “I feel” instead of “You always.” These shifts invite dialogue rather than defensiveness.
